The Correct, Legal Way to Get a Polish Driving License
For those lawfully living in Poland (holding a legitimate visa, house card, or EU citizenship) who want to drive legally, the right course involves a number of structured steps:
- Obtain a Profil Kandydata na Kierowcę (PKK):
- This is the Driver Candidate Profile. You must send an application at your local driving license office (Wydział Komunikacji), together with a medical certificate, a passport-sized picture, and evidence of legal residence.
- Total Medical and Psychological Exams:
- A licensed occupational physician must test your vision, hearing, and general health to ensure you are healthy to drive.
- Participate In Driving School (Ośrodek Szkolenia KierowcóOdnowienie prawa jazdy w Polsce - OSK):
- Complete the needed theoretical and practical hours.
- Pass State Exams at WORD:
- Pass the computer-based theory exam (available in Polish, English, and German) followed by the practical driving examination.
- Collect Your License:
- Once passed, the information updates in CEPiK, and your physical card is produced and ready for pickup.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: Can immigrants legally convert their home country's driving license in Poland?
Answer: Yes. If you hold a driving license provided by an EU/EFTA member state, you can drive with it until it expires. If your license is from a non-EU nation that is a signatory to the 1968 Vienna Convention (e.g., UK, Ukraine, USA-- depending upon the state), you can normally exchange it for a Polish driving license after residing in Poland for at least 185 days, typically needing a translation and passing the theoretical examination (though useful tests are often waived depending on bilateral contracts).
Q2: Are online offers claiming "no examination, registered in database" genuine?
Response: No. Legitimate driving licenses in Poland can not be provided without passing the necessary state assessments administered by WORD and completing a certified training course. Any claim to bypass this is either a scam or an unlawful bribery plan, both of which carry extreme legal consequences.
Q3: How long does it legally take to get a driving license in Poland?
Response: On average, the entire procedure takes in between 2 to 4 months, depending on how rapidly you complete your driving school hours, book your exam dates at WORD, and procedure your documents through the regional municipality.
